Yesterday is a commonly used word to refer to the day immediately preceding today. However, there are other synonyms that can be used to express the same meaning. The word "yesteryear" can be used to refer to a time long past, while "recently" can be utilized to indicate a recent occurrence. The phrase "the day before" can also be substituted for yesterday, as well as the term "the past" to describe the previous day or period. Other popular synonyms for yesterday include "the former day," "bygone times," or simply "last day." Those looking to convey the meaning of yesterday without using the word itself have a variety of options to choose from.
